Sat 709528993806094

decimal
141905.3993806094
degree
0°141905′785″3993806094‴
percentile
33.78709498031316%
name
ivbllzvnnzv
cycle
0
epoch
0
period
70
block
141905
offset
3993806094
timestamp
rarity
common
inscriptions
location
78faffd4eafc7fa5d99062705f104a9ca3547e4f89cfe65085abb33e6a06a0d2:1:1364142222
address
31nXEifPqiUL3hqfTP5epd93s3ShNLnWL4